Hi Katie,
If you go to the Layers, and click on the "Gear" icon, you will see the option(s) for switching off the Base and Other layers.
Also, you can go to the slide you are on, and you will see the Base Layer showing at the bottom of the Timeline, Click the arrow to reveal all the objects, and you can selectively switch objects on and off.
